/***************************************************************************//*                                                                         *//*  ftstroke.h                                                             *//*                                                                         *//*    FreeType path stroker (specification).                               *//*                                                                         *//*  Copyright 2002, 2003 by                                                *//*  David Turner, Robert Wilhelm, and Werner Lemberg.                      *//*                                                                         *//*  This file is part of the FreeType project, and may only be used,       *//*  modified, and distributed under the terms of the FreeType project      *//*  license, LICENSE.TXT.  By continuing to use, modify, or distribute     *//*  this file you indicate that you have read the license and              *//*  understand and accept it fully.                                        *//*                                                                         *//***************************************************************************/#ifndef __FT_STROKE_H__#define __FT_STROKE_H__#include <ft2build.h>#include FT_OUTLINE_HFT_BEGIN_HEADER/*@************************************************************* * * @type: FT_Stroker * * @description: *    opaque handler to a path stroker object */  typedef struct FT_StrokerRec_*    FT_Stroker;/*@************************************************************* * * @enum: FT_Stroker_LineJoin * * @description: *    these values determine how two joining lines are rendered *    in a stroker. * * @values: *    FT_STROKER_LINEJOIN_ROUND :: *      used to render rounded line joins. circular arcs are used *      to join two lines smoothly * *    FT_STROKER_LINEJOIN_BEVEL :: *      used to render beveled line joins; i.e. the two joining lines *      are extended until they intersect * *    FT_STROKER_LINEJOIN_MITER :: *      same as beveled rendering, except that an additional line *      break is added if the angle between the two joining lines *      is too closed (this is useful to avoid unpleasant spikes *      in beveled rendering). */  typedef enum  {    FT_STROKER_LINEJOIN_ROUND = 0,    FT_STROKER_LINEJOIN_BEVEL,    FT_STROKER_LINEJOIN_MITER  } FT_Stroker_LineJoin;/*@************************************************************* * * @enum: FT_Stroker_LineCap * * @description: *    these values determine how the end of opened sub-paths are *    rendered in a stroke * * @values: *    FT_STROKER_LINECAP_BUTT :: *      the end of lines is rendered as a full stop on the last *      point itself * *    FT_STROKER_LINECAP_ROUND :: *      the end of lines is rendered as a half-circle around the *      last point * *    FT_STROKER_LINECAP_SQUARE :: *      the end of lines is rendered as a square around the *      last point */  typedef enum  {    FT_STROKER_LINECAP_BUTT = 0,    FT_STROKER_LINECAP_ROUND,    FT_STROKER_LINECAP_SQUARE  } FT_Stroker_LineCap; /* */  FT_EXPORT( FT_Error )  FT_Stroker_New( FT_Memory    memory,                  FT_Stroker  *astroker );  FT_EXPORT( void )  FT_Stroker_Set( FT_Stroker           stroker,                  FT_Fixed             radius,                  FT_Stroker_LineCap   line_cap,                  FT_Stroker_LineJoin  line_join,                  FT_Fixed             miter_limit );  FT_EXPORT( FT_Error )  FT_Stroker_ParseOutline( FT_Stroker   stroker,                           FT_Outline*  outline,                           FT_Bool      opened );  FT_EXPORT( FT_Error )  FT_Stroker_BeginSubPath( FT_Stroker  stroker,                           FT_Vector*  to,                           FT_Bool     open );  FT_EXPORT( FT_Error )  FT_Stroker_EndSubPath( FT_Stroker  stroker );  FT_EXPORT( FT_Error )  FT_Stroker_LineTo( FT_Stroker  stroker,                     FT_Vector*  to );  FT_EXPORT( FT_Error )  FT_Stroker_ConicTo( FT_Stroker  stroker,                      FT_Vector*  control,                      FT_Vector*  to );  FT_EXPORT( FT_Error )  FT_Stroker_CubicTo( FT_Stroker  stroker,                      FT_Vector*  control1,                      FT_Vector*  control2,                      FT_Vector*  to );  FT_EXPORT( FT_Error )  FT_Stroker_GetCounts( FT_Stroker  stroker,                        FT_UInt    *anum_points,                        FT_UInt    *anum_contours );  FT_EXPORT( void )  FT_Stroker_Export( FT_Stroker   stroker,                     FT_Outline*  outline );  FT_EXPORT( void )  FT_Stroker_Done( FT_Stroker  stroker );FT_END_HEADER#endif /* __FT_STROKE_H__ *//* END */
